- The distance between Murcia/ San Javier, Spain and Guasdualito, Venezuela is approximately 7,761 km or 4,823 mi.
- To reach Murcia/ San Javier in this distance one would set out from Guasdualito bearing 52.3°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Murcia/ San Javier bearing 83.4° or E .
- Murcia/ San Javier has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Guasdualito has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Murcia/ San Javier is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ome whereas Guasdualito is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 8.9 °C (16°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.6 °C (20.9°F) more in Murcia/ San Javier.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1431 mm (56.3 in) less which is equivalent to 1431 l/m² (35.12 US gal/ft²) or 14,310,000 l/ha (1,529,834 US gal/ac) less. About 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 22° lower in Murcia/ San Javier than in Guasdualito.
